Mumtaz Mahal is a pretty good place with nice views if you are doing the tourist thing. It's a 15 minute drive from the Hyatt.

However, the best back street Indian restaurant in Muscat is Begum's in Al Khuwair, but there's no grog.

Any high end hotel in your area will have good Indian food as it is almost a staple here in Muscat.

As an alternative, I highly recommend Shiraz Iranian restaurant at the Crowne Plaza. Has it all, including a great view over the sea.
